This badland beak in the prairie is at Paint Mines Park in El Paso County, Colorado.
The native people used to go there to get pigments. The park is mostly prairie, but has some small badland areas.
Canon 1dMIII, 16-35 mm at 22mm, 1/250 sec at f/10, ISO 100. Silver Efex conversion.
